    "Gaza”: a cinematic journey through resilience and struggle

    TEHRAN-"Gaza" is a documentary directed by Garry Keane and Andrew McConnell, produced in 2019 by Ireland, Canada, and Germany. This documentary takes audiences on an 86-minute exploration of the daily struggles and resilience of the people living in this small strip of land. Filmed between the Israeli war in 2014 and the border protests in 2018, "Gaza" is backed by Ireland and premiered at Sundance before kicking off its international release at the Dublin Film Festival.
